Overview

Postcode S5 8AQ is located in a minor urban area, within the Southey ward of Sheffield in the Yorkshire and The Humber region, and forms part of the Parson Cross area. It has very high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 175.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, roughly 1.6× the Yorkshire and The Humber average of 113 per 1,000. The average income per household in Parson Cross is £38,997 per year. The nearest station is Chapeltown (South Yorkshire), about 2.7 miles away. There are 9 primary and 3 secondary schools in the area. There is 1 park nearby, the closest large park is Parson Cross Park.

Deprivation level

10/10

Parson Cross has a very high level of deprivation, ranked at position 1,828 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the top 6% most deprived areas in England.

Crime level

10/10

Parson Cross has a very high crime rate, with approximately 175.7 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.

Social housing

33.7%

Approximately 33.7%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 41.1% of dwellings are socially rented.

Income level

2/10

The average income per household in Parson Cross is £38,997 per year.

Noise Level

No noise

No significant noise sources from railways or roads near S5 8AQ.

Flood risk

No risk

Parson Cross near S5 8AQ has no fl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.

Transport

The nearest station is Chapeltown (South Yorkshire) located about 2.7 miles away. There are no other stations nearby.
